def initialize(profile='dev', config=None):
    if profile == 'dev':
        database = SqliteDatabase(':memory:')
    else:
        if config.name == 'sqlite':
            database = PooledSqliteExtDatabase(config.db_file, max_connections=32, stale_timeout=600,
                                               pragmas={
                                                   'journal_mode': 'wal',
                                                   'cache_size': -1 * 64000,  # 64MB
                                                   'foreign_keys': 1,
                                                   'ignore_check_constraints': 0,
                                                   'synchronous': 0})
        else:
            raise ValueError(f'Not supported {config.name}.')

    database_proxy.initialize(database)

from decouple import config

# from peewee import SqliteDatabase
from playhouse.pool import PooledSqliteExtDatabase  # , PooledPostgresqlExtDatabase

db_name = config("DATABASE_PATH", default="covid19_tracker.db")
path = os.getcwd().split("code")[0]
path = f"{path}code"

# db = SqliteDatabase(config('DATABASE_PATH', default='covid19_tracker.db'))
db = PooledSqliteExtDatabase(
    f"{path}/{db_name}",
    pragmas={
        "journal_mode": "wal",  # WAL-mode.
        "cache_size": -64 * 1000,  # 64MB cache.
        "foreign_keys": 1,
        "synchronous": 0,
    },
    max_connections=150,
    stale_timeout=3600,
    check_same_thread=False,
)
